Gene summary | Predicted to enable mRNA binding activity. Involved in negative regulation of neuron projection development. Predicted to be located in nucleus. Predicted to be part of THO complex part of transcription export complex. Predicted to colocalize with chromosome, telomeric region. Human ortholog(s) of this gene implicated in X-linked intellectual disability-short stature-overweight syndrome. Orthologous to human THOC2 (THO complex 2).
